The purpose of this document is to indicate the compatibility of various software with promis•e. It is not intended to describe compatibility of the various software with each other. For example, certain versions of SQL Server may not be compatible with certain operating systems. Always check the documentation of the various software involved.

There is no promis•e V8i SELECTseries 4. The SELECTseries release after SELECTseries 3 was named SELECTseries 5 in order to match the concurrent release of Bentley Substation V8i SELECTseries 5.
Beginning with promis•e V8i SELECTseries 5, the "Standalone" version of promis•e has the MicroStation CAD engine built into the promis•e install. Going forward there will not be new "add-on" versions for MicroStation or PowerDraft.

Important Notes:
AccessDatabaseEnginex64 is included with 64-bit Microsoft Office 2010 but can also be downloaded and installed separately. Download AccessDatabaseEngine_x64.exe.
Office 2007 is a 32-bit application only, and the AccessDatabaseEngine_x64 cannot be installed on top of it. To use Office 2007 and 64-bit promis•e, install AccessDatabaseEngine_x64 prior to (re)installing Office 2007.
If Office 2010 is to be used on the same workstation as 64-bit promis•e, install the 64-bit version of Office 2010. In one case with 64-bit promis•e, it was still required to install AccessDatabaseEngine_x64 separately after installing 64-bit Office 365.

32-bit Standalone promis•e should operate on a system with 64-bit Microsoft Office installed with no additional action necessary.
promis.e is currently only certified on English SQL Server versions, even for versions of promis.e localized for other languages. The SQL_Latin1_General_CP1_CI_AS collation is recommended.
Install the 32-bit version of the client if using 32-bit promis•e even if the operating system is 64-bit (i.e. using promis•e Standalone). Install the 64-bit client if using 64-bit promis•e (i.e.promis•e for 64-bit AutoCAD).
For Oracle 11g with promis•e V8i SS6 and SS7, install the 11.2.0.2.0 Instant Client. Installing the Oracle Universal Installer ODAC112021.zip is a convenient way to install this client and other the other requirements for Oracle with promis•e V8i.
For Oracle 11g with promis•e V8i SS2 through SS5, install the 11.1.0.7.0 Instant Client. Installing the Oracle Universal Installer ODAC1110720.zip is a convenient way to install this client and other the other requirements for Oracle with promis•e V8i.
Later releases of the Oracle 11g client such as 11.2.0.1.0 are not compatible with promis•e V8i SS2 through SS5. Even though it is not certified for Windows 7, ODAC 11.1.0.7.20 will work in that operating system.
For promis•e V8i SELECTseries 5 - 7 and Oracle 10g server, v10.2.0.4 or higher is compatible.
